New Machine Software and EC520 Controller Monitor Software Is Now Available for Certain Excavators {7490, 7601, 7610, 7620} Caterpillar

New machine software and new EC520 controller monitor software is now available for the machines listed above. The new software contains the following improvements:

  • Tilt sensor diagnostic codes.

  • Grade application display in machine monitor.

  • Machine controller communication with EC520 controller.

The new software is available in the form of a flash file through the Caterpillar Service Information System (SIS). A newer software part may be available . SIS web only displays the latest available flash file.
